Note for:   John Beard,   9 DEC 1871 - 1950         Index

Occupation:   
     Place:   President of TGWU

Residence:   
     Date:   1891
     Place:   Ercall Magna, Shropshire, England

Individual Note:
     Author of My Shropshire Days on Common Ways. Met Dora while staying at Boarding House run by Eliza Jane Perrigo (m 39). Dora was a maid there and Owner told her not to talk to John as he didn't talk in the mornings. She did, and the rest is history....John had polio as a child and one leg was smaller than the other. He played the banjo and painted. Said to be a very interesting man. Had a block of flats named after him in Telford. Tombstone in Shawley church yard with the names of all the family written on it.
